What Body of Evidence is like to read

A forensic procedural built around a missing manuscript and a methodical medical examiner — clinical detail braided with mounting personal danger. Best for: readers who want forensic detail and a competent professional lead driving the investigation.

The Silence of the Lambs cover
The Silence of the Lambs
Thomas Harris · 1988
A procedural manhunt braided with the most famous interview in modern thriller fiction — clipped, clinical prose that keeps escalating dread while Clarice trades wits with Lecter against a ticking clock.

About Body of Evidence — what the genome says

Is Body of Evidence a complete story or a cliffhanger?

It's a complete, standalone-satisfying story.

How scary is Body of Evidence?

Creepy and atmospheric rather than gory or traumatizing.

Who is Body of Evidence for?

readers who want forensic detail and a competent professional lead driving the investigation
